Video Transcript

"Pretty soon people are going to start seeing how well you've been doing. And I hate to be the one to tell you this, but there's always someone itching to beat the fastest gun. You will be attacked if you play Travian, and you need to know how to defend yourself. That's all there is to it. I am going to tell you how to make sure that you optimize your defensive potential to smash anyone who thinks that they can mess with you. You've got a couple of different strategies. The first strategy is called the wall. That's where you gear up all of your defensive troops throw them wherever the attack is going to hit and just hope for the best. This is a really good strategy if you are big, and you're attacker isn't. It's a very bad strategy if your attacker is strong enough to kill all of your troops, because then you are left with nothing. The second defensive strategy is to dodge the attack. It may seem counterintuitive to just move all of your troops away from a village that's going to be attacked, but the odds are that village isn't going to get hurt too much anyway and you'll be protecting the lives of your troops. The final strategy is to counter that attack, which is a variant on dodging. Instead of just sending the troops away you actually attack your opponent while he is attacking you, and while his troops are away, you are damaging his village in turn."
